<div dir="ltr">This is just damn strange.  All of a sudden (well, for the past few weeks), I CAN NOT create ANY port on the public network.   Just tore down and recreated the public net from scratch.   What's going on here!!!????<div><br></div><div>It's stuck trying to create the DHCP agent's port.  This is why it's stuck in BUILD.  Infinite loop.    BTW, the Compute node is at 172.22.10.99.   Maybe I should just change that.  But it would be really nice to know what changed and why this is happening.</div><div><br></div><div><br></div><div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     resync_a = self.treat_devices_added_updated(devices_added_updated)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 1045, in treat_devices_added_updated</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     device_details['port_id'], device_details['device_owner'])</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 542, in add_interface</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     tap_device_name, device_owner)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 480, in add_tap_interface</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     return False</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/oslo_utils/excutils.py", line 195, in __exit__</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     six.reraise(self.type_, self.value, self.tb)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 472, in add_tap_interface</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     tap_device_name, device_owner)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 504, in _add_tap_interface</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     segmentation_id)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 456, in ensure_physical_in_bridge</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     physical_interface)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 275, in ensure_flat_bridge</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     gateway):</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 416, in ensure_bridge</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     self.update_interface_ip_details(bridge_name, interface, ips, gateway)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/plugins/ml2/drivers/linuxbridge/agent/linuxbridge_neutron_agent.py", line 355, in update_interface_ip_details</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     dst_device.addr.add(cidr=ip['cidr'])</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/agent/linux/ip_lib.py", line 548, in add</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     self._as_root([net.version], tuple(args))</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/agent/linux/ip_lib.py", line 338, in _as_root</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     use_root_namespace=use_root_namespace)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/agent/linux/ip_lib.py", line 92, in _as_root</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     log_fail_as_error=self.log_fail_as_error)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/agent/linux/ip_lib.py", line 101, in _execute</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     log_fail_as_error=log_fail_as_error)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ent   File "/usr/lib/python2.7/site-packages/neutron/agent/linux/utils.py", line 159, in execute</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ent     raise RuntimeError(m)</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ent RuntimeError: </div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ent Command: ['ip', '-4', 'addr', 'add', '<a href="http://172.22.10.99/24">172.22.10.99/24</a>', 'scope', 'global', 'dev', u'brq10ee1383-ca', 'brd', '172.22.10.255']</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ent Exit code: 2</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ent Stdin: </div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ent Stdout: </div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ent Stderr: RTNETLINK answers: File exists</div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ent </div><div>2017-11-05 10:44:10.802 1574 ERROR neutron.plugins.ml2.drivers.linuxbridge.agent.linuxbridge_neutron_agent </div><div>[root@maersk neutron]# date</div><div>Sun Nov  5 10:44:16 PST 2017</div><div><br></div><div><br></div><div><br></div></div><div><br></div><div><br></div></div><div class="gmail_extra"><br clear="all"><div><div class="g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div><div>- Christopher T. Hull</div><div>Sunnyvale CA. 94085<br>(415) 385 4865<br></div><div><a href="mailto:chrishull42@gmail.com" target="_blank">chrishull42@gmail.com</a><br></div><a href="http://chrishull.com" target="_blank">http://chrishull.com</a><br><br></div><div><div><br></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div>
<br><div class="gmail_quote">On Sun, Nov 5, 2017 at 10:40 AM, Christopher Hull <span dir="ltr"><<a href="mailto:chrishull42@gmail.com" target="_blank">chrishull42@gmail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ex"><div dir="ltr"><div><font face="monospace, monospace">HI all;</font></div><div><font face="monospace, monospace">Trying to create DHCP on the Public network.  This had been working, but now all of a sudden the ports are set to BUILD instead of AVAILABLE.</font></div><div><font face="monospace, monospace"><br></font></div><div><font face="monospace, monospace">I did a cheat in MariaDB and discovered that something somewhere keeps setting DHCP to BUILD.   Any ideas?</font></div><div><font face="monospace, monospace"><br></font></div><div><font face="monospace, monospace"><br></font></div><div>







<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">MariaDB [neutron]><span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>update ports set status='AVAILABLE' where id ='37cc930c-6ad3-4355-8ff5-<wbr>6b75e131c998';</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">Query OK, 1 row affected (0.05 sec)</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">Rows matched: 1<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>Changed: 1<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>Warnings: 0</font></b></span></p>
<p class="m_-4345133651150320620gmail-p2"><font face="monospace, monospace"><span class="m_-4345133651150320620gmail-s1"><b></b></span><br></font></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">MariaDB [neutron]> select status, id<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>from ports;</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+-----------+-----------------<wbr>---------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| status<span class="m_-4345133651150320620gmail-Apple-converted-space">    </span>| id <span class="m_-4345133651150320620gmail-Apple-converted-space">                                  </span>|</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+-----------+-----------------<wbr>---------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| BUILD <span class="m_-4345133651150320620gmail-Apple-converted-space">    </span>| 0ebbaf42-6bd9-4853-b041-<wbr>e00f3da4dd89 |</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| AVAILABLE | 37cc930c-6ad3-4355-8ff5-<wbr>6b75e131c998 |</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+-----------+-----------------<wbr>---------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">2 rows in set (0.00 sec)</font></b></span></p>
<p class="m_-4345133651150320620gmail-p2"><font face="monospace, monospace"><span class="m_-4345133651150320620gmail-s1"><b></b></span><br></font></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">MariaDB [neutron]> select status, id<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>from ports;</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+--------+--------------------<wbr>------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| status | id <span class="m_-4345133651150320620gmail-Apple-converted-space">                                  </span>|</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+--------+--------------------<wbr>------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| BUILD<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>| 0ebbaf42-6bd9-4853-b041-<wbr>e00f3da4dd89 |</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">| BUILD<span class="m_-4345133651150320620gmail-Apple-converted-space">  </span>| 37cc930c-6ad3-4355-8ff5-<wbr>6b75e131c998 |</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">+--------+--------------------<wbr>------------------+</font></b></span></p>
<p class="m_-4345133651150320620gmail-p1"><span class="m_-4345133651150320620gmail-s1"><b><font face="monospace, monospace">2 rows in set (0.00 sec)</font></b></span></p>
<p class="m_-4345133651150320620gmail-p2"><font face="monospace, monospace"><span class="m_-4345133651150320620gmail-s1"><b></b></span><br></font></p><p class="m_-4345133651150320620gmail-p2"><font face="monospace, monospace"><br></font></p></div><div><font face="monospace, monospace"><br></font></div><div><font face="monospace, monospace"><br></font></div><font face="monospace, monospace"><br clear="all"></font><div><div class="m_-4345133651150320620g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div><div><font face="monospace, monospace">- Christopher T. Hull</font></div><div><font face="monospace, monospace">Sunnyvale CA. 94085<br><a href="tel:(415)%20385-4865" value="+14153854865" target="_blank">(415) 385 4865</a><br></font></div><div><font face="monospace, monospace"><a href="mailto:chrishull42@gmail.com" target="_blank">chrishull42@gmail.com</a><br></font></div><font face="monospace, monospace"><a href="http://chrishull.com" target="_blank">http://chrishull.com</a><br><br></font></div><div><div><br></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div></div>
</div>
</blockquote></div><br></div>